How many miles can a cherokee sport take?
I am trying to buy a cherokee sport but almost all of the ones iv'e seen for sale have anywhere from 170,000 to 220,000 miles on them. I want to buy one but i dont want it to fall apart on me and I don't have much money for repairs. The years iv'e seen were 1996-2001

365,000 and still going strong on mine. Original 4.0L engine, rebuilt AX-15 transmission. If I was in the market for another XJ, I wouldn't even hesitate buying one with the 4.0L and 150,000+ miles as long as it looks like it was well taken care of.
